Second-generation SAF1576 reduces power requirements by 50 percent through integration
Philips Semiconductors today announced the new low-cost SAF1576, a single-chip GPS (Global Positioning System) baseband receiver with embedded system RAM (Random Access Memory) and ROM (Read Only Memory) to simplify a manufacturers' design time. This low-power device operates with a 3-volt supply and decreases the power requirements by nearly 50 percent without sacrificing performance. The SAF1576 requires only 30 milliamps, which is a significant reduction from the 60 milliamps needed by the first-generation solution. Using a space saving 44-pin Quad Flat package, the SAF1576 front-end device provides manufacturers with a comprehensive, low-cost GPS device in a small form factor. This combination of functionality, cost and size are critical for manufacturers of consumer-focused GPS applications, such as car navigation and vehicle location and tracking.
